What is the A Minor 7 Chord?

A Minor 7 Chord
Before we dive into the finger position for the A minor 7 chord, let's first define what this chord is. The A minor 7 chord is a four-note chord that contains the notes A, C, E, and G. When played in succession, these notes create a mellow and melancholic sound that's perfect for emotional ballads, jazz, and Bossa Nova.

Using the A Minor 7 Chord in Your Playing

Using The A Minor 7 Chord In Indonesia
Now that you know the finger position for the A minor 7 chord, it's time to start incorporating it into your playing. Here are some tips to help you use this chord effectively:1. Switch between the A minor 7 chord and other chords in your repertoire to create interesting progressions.2. Experiment with different strumming patterns to find the one that sounds best with the A minor 7 chord.3. Use the A minor 7 chord as a substitution for the regular A minor chord to create a more complex sound.4. Practice playing the A minor 7 chord with different tempos and rhythms to improve your overall playing ability.
